Learn more about Hessel

This charming Upper Peninsula village hosts the annual Les Cheneaux Islands Antique Wooden Boat Show, where beautifully restored vessels gather each August. Kayak through the protected waters of the Les Cheneaux archipelago or fish for pike and bass in the sheltered bays.

Best time to go to Hessel

The best time to visit Hessel can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Hessel falls in August,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Hessel falls in February, visitor numbers are low and weather is very cloudy with no rain (dry).

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January19.8°F (-6.8°C)No Rain (Dry)Very CloudyLowModerately Low
February18.9°F (-7.3°C)No Rain (Dry)Very CloudyLowAverage
March27.1°F (-2.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May48.4°F (9.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ageModerately High
July65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ighModerately High
August66.0°F (18.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ighModerately High
September59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
October48.4°F (9.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November37.4°F (3.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ageModerately Low
December27.7°F (-2.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owModerately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Hessel

Flying into Hessel, Michigan, you have convenient access to several airports. Sault Ste. Marie, ON (YAM-Sault Ste. Marie Airport) is approximately 20.5km away, with nearby hotels such as Delta Hotels by Marriott Sault Ste. Marie Waterfront and Holiday Inn Express Sault Ste Marie, both around 5.0km from the airport, offering shuttle services. Sault Ste. Marie, MI (CIU-Chippewa County Intl.) is situated 15.0km from Hessel, with Willabees Motel located 7.5km away. Additionally, Mackinac Island, MI (MCD) is 8.7km from Hessel, featuring hotel options like Mission Point Resort and Island House Hotel, both within 1.2km of the airport.
